随着前端技术的不断发展,前端开发变得越来越复杂,需要处理的内容也日益增多。为了更好地管理和组织前端代码,npm 包已成为前端开发中不可或缺的一部分。其中,sfdx-mdx 是一款特别有用的 npm 包,它可以帮助我们更方便地构建和管理前端项目中的 markdown 文档。
接下来就让我为大家介绍 sfdx-mdx 的使用方法和具体操作。
安装 sfdx-mdx
在开始使用 sfdx-mdx 之前,我们首先需要安装它。可以使用以下命令:
npm install -g sfdx-mdx
经过上面的步骤,就已经安装了 sfdx-mdx 这个包,现在我们就可以开始构建自己的项目了。
使用 sfdx-mdx
sfdx-mdx 可以将 markdown 文件转化为 HTML,可以提供极大的方便。下面,我们将详细介绍如何使用这个库。
1. 创建 Markdown 文件
首先,我们需要先创建一个 markdown 文件。例如,我们可以在项目的根目录下创建一个 README.md 文件。
2. 创建 sfdx-mdx 配置文件
接下来,我们需要创建 sfdx-mdx 配置文件,以告诉 sfdx-mdx 如何转换 markdown 文件。在项目的根目录下创建一个名为 sfdx.json 的文件(或者使用默认的 .sfdx-mdx.json 文件名)并添加以下内容:
{ "inputDir": ".", "outputDir": "./output", "plugins": [ "@sfdx/remark-plugin" ] }
在上面的代码中,我们定义了输入目录、输出目录以及使用的插件。这里使用的是 @sfdx/remark-plugin,它是 sfdx-mdx 的一个默认插件。这个插件可以帮助我们生成 HTML,从而方便地展示 markdown 文档。
3. 运行 sfdx-mdx
接下来,我们只需要在命令行中运行以下命令即可:
sfdx-mdx
在运行上述命令之后,会在 output 目录下生成一个 index.html 文件。现在我们只需要打开 index.html 文件,就可以看到我们刚才编写的 markdown 文档已经转化为了一个漂亮的 HTML 页面。
总结
上面我们已经介绍了如何使用 sfdx-mdx 这个 npm 包,希望这篇教程能够帮助你更高效地管理和组织你的前端项目中的 markdown 文档。当然,sfdx-mdx 还有许多其他更加高级的使用方法,感兴趣的朋友可以前往官网查看更多文档。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60066e18a563576b7b1ecb6c